Procter & Gamble Hygiene & Health Care Ltd Gains 6.27%: 2 Key Factors Driving the Move
Procter & Gamble Hygiene & Health Care Ltd delivered a notable weekly gain of 6.27%, closing at Rs.9,763.40 on 2 April 2026, significantly outperforming the Sensex which declined by 0.29% over the same period. The stock rebounded strongly from a 52-week low of Rs.8,995 on 30 March, driven by a combination of market recovery and intraday momentum, despite lingering valuation concerns and a cautious technical outlook.

Procter & Gamble Hygiene & Health Care Ltd Falls 7.65%: 6 Key Factors Driving the Decline
Procter & Gamble Hygiene & Health Care Ltd experienced a challenging week from 16 to 20 March 2026, with its stock price declining 7.65% to close at Rs.9,716.75, significantly underperforming the Sensex which fell a modest 0.28%. The stock hit successive 52-week lows throughout the week amid bearish technical signals, valuation concerns, and subdued growth metrics despite strong quarterly earnings and profitability ratios.
